Synonyms of piggyback

Noun


1. piggyback, carry

usage: the act of carrying something piggyback

Verb


1. piggyback, ride

usage: ride on someone's shoulders or back

2. piggyback, haul

usage: haul truck trailers loaded with commodities on railroad cars

3. piggyback, haul

usage: haul by railroad car

4. piggyback, hold, carry, bear

usage: support on the back and shoulders; "He piggybacked her child so she could see the show"

5. piggyback, change, alter, modify

usage: bring into alignment with; "an amendment to piggyback the current law"

Adverb


1. piggyback, pickaback, pig-a-back

usage: on a railroad flatcar; "the trailer rode piggyback across the country"

2. piggyback, pickaback, pig-a-back

usage: on the back or shoulder or astraddle on the hip; "she carried her child piggyback"
